Tanker Hill is in Gillingham and in Gillingham district. ME8 9EU is located in the Rainham South East elect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Gillingham and Rainham.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Tanker Hill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Tanker Hill was 10.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 79.2% lower than the Hempstead & Wigmore average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Tanker Hill has the 13th lowest crime rate of 63 local areas in Hempstead & Wigmore and the 39th lowest crime rate of 820 local areas in Medway .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 8.1 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-25.0%.

Employment

ME8 9EU area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 12%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 14%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

ME8 9EU area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
